Convert PKCS12 / PFX to Java Keystore (JKS)

Loads a PKCS12 / PFX file and saves it to a Java keystore (JKS) file.

use chilkat();

$success = 0;

# This example requires the Chilkat API to have been previously unlocked.
# See Global Unlock Sample for sample code.

$pfx = chilkat::CkPfx->new();

# Load the PKCS12 from a file
$success = $pfx->LoadPfxFile("/someDir/my.p12","myPfxPassword");
if ($success == 0) {
    print $pfx->lastErrorText() . "\r\n";
    exit;
}

$jksPassword = "myJksPassword";
$alias = "firstPrivateKeyAlias";

$jks = chilkat::CkJavaKeyStore->new();

# Convert to a Java keystore object.
# The jksPassword is the password to be used for the JKS private key entries. 
# It may be the same as the PFX password, but can also be different if desired.
$success = $pfx->ToJksObj($alias,$jksPassword,$jks);
if ($success == 0) {
    print $pfx->lastErrorText() . "\r\n";
    exit;
}

# Save the Java keystore to a file.
$success = $jks->ToFile($jksPassword,"/myKeystores/my.jks");
if ($success != 1) {
    print $jks->lastErrorText() . "\r\n";

    exit;
}

print "Successfully converted PFX to JKS." . "\r\n";
